Remodeling an inground pool offers a unique opportunity to transform its design and aesthetics. With the addition of contemporary design features, you can achieve a beautiful and welcoming pool space.
- Renewing the Pool Surface and Tiles: A significant update to consider during remodeling is updating the pool's surface and tiles. Selecting high-quality, stylish materials including quartz, pebble, or glass tiles can greatly elevate the pool's look and longevity.
- Integrating Water Features: Adding modern water features can enhance the pool's appeal and enjoyment. Explore options such as waterfalls, fountains, or jets to create a dynamic and relaxing environment. These elements not only enhance the visual appeal but also improve the swimming experience for everyone.
Enhancing Pool FunctionalityUpgrading your inground pool is a perfect chance to enhance its functionality and usability. Modernizing equipment and incorporating new features can make the pool more practical and efficient.
- Modernizing Pool Equipment: Replacing old, inefficient equipment with advanced, energy-saving equipment can significantly improve the pool's performance. Explore options like variable-speed pumps, energy-efficient heaters, and high-performance filters to reduce energy consumption and operating costs.
- Adding Automation Features: Implementing automation systems can simplify pool operations and enhance convenience. Automation for temperature, chemicals, and cleaning can minimize manual work and keep the pool in top condition. Innovative pool tech allows you to manage your pool remotely using a smartphone or tablet.
Improving Pool Safety and StandardsA pool renovation provides an opportunity to boost safety elements and comply with regulations. Enhancing safety systems not only safeguards pool users but also adheres to safety regulations.
- Installing Safety Barriers: Enhancing or adding safety fences and gates including fences, gates, and pool covers can prevent accidents and unauthorized access. These features are particularly important for pools used by families and children.
- Enhancing Drain and Suction Safety: Modernizing drains and suction outlets for safety compliance is crucial for preventing entrapment incidents. Installing anti-entrapment drain covers and ensuring proper suction configurations can greatly improve safety and regulatory compliance.
